A consistent loop that checks for input and updates the display is essential for creating a responsive and immersive control scheme. You cannot create true 3D models, but you can simulate the feeling of moving through a 3D world.
Essential Scratch 3D Environment Design Tips for Building Your Game
Structuring the Code Organization is vital when simulating 3D. You should create custom blocks (functions) to handle repetitive tasks, such as drawing the grid, rendering walls, or calculating the FOV (Field of View).
This mathematical approach is the bedrock of your 3D simulation. By using variables to store the player's X, Y, and Z coordinates, as well as their rotation angle, you can update the screen efficiently.
Essential Scratch 3D Environment Design Tips
To prevent the game from feeling sluggish, ensure you adjust the movement speed relative to the frame rate. A successful 3D environment, even a simple one, requires a clear design.
More About How to make a 3d game in scratch
Looking at How to make a 3d game in scratch from another angle can help expand the discussion and give readers a second clear paragraph under the same section.
More perspective on How to make a 3d game in scratch can make the topic easier to follow by connecting earlier points with a few simple takeaways.